WebKinetics is the study of the rates of chemical processes. The rate of a reaction is defined at the change in concentration over time: Rate Expressions describe reactions in terms of the change in reactant or … WebThe brackets themselves mean the "concentration" of whatever molecule is inside of them. So the rate expression means the change in concentration over the change in time. Experimentally, chemists measure the concentration of a reactant or product over a period of time to see the rate at which the molecules disappear or appear.
